Miami is ahead of the curve

https://www.bizjournals.com/southflorida/news/2023/03/28/final-four-nil-marketing-power-of-um-fau-teams.html

"The LifeWallet deal with Kansas State transfer Nijel Pack was reportedly $800,000 for two years, and he wound up winning MVP of the Midwest Region in the NCAA Tournament. The LifeWallet team also includes his teammates Jordan Miller, Norchad Omier and Atlantic Coast Conference Player of the Year Isaiah Wong. As the Hurricanes head to a high-profile national semifinal game and enjoy a week of pre-game publicity, Ruiz’s LifeWallet brand also will garner the spotlight."

Far from concluding this is a poor investment, the success of Miami this year is going to be held up as the example that if you do NIL right, it definitely leads to success. 

The other problem with the original post is that it only considers the final result in its definition of success--I doubt Houston is not going to give up on lining up NIL for players because they were upset before the final four.  The learning there is that their NIL program put them in a position to succeed this year.  They fell short, but that doesn't mean it was a poor investment.
